Mailman + postfix

Fórumok

Mailman + postfix

Hozzászólások

Sziasztok!

Feltettem debianra a mailman-t. Eddig postfix volt, mint smtp szerver.
Szepen megy a webes felulete a mailmannak listat is letre tudok hozni.
Fel is tudok iratkozni, DE a confirmation emailt mar nem kapom meg. Listara mar nem tudok kuldeni.

mailman logokban (/var/log/mailman/subscribe) latom hogy pending subscrbe-en van a felhasznalo.

Mas emailcimre se kuldd, de meg a lokalis emailcimekre se jon meg a confiramtion level. Postfix nem logol ezzel kapcoslatban semmit a /var/log/mail.* fajlokba.

Merre tudok elindulni?
(postfix kifogastalanul mukodik a mailmanon kivul)

Udv,
Khiraly

Szia'

[quote:34071bb578="khiraly"]Sziasztok!

Feltettem debianra a mailman-t. Eddig postfix volt, mint smtp szerver.
Szepen megy a webes felulete a mailmannak listat is letre tudok hozni.
Fel is tudok iratkozni, DE a confirmation emailt mar nem kapom meg. Listara mar nem tudok kuldeni.

mailman logokban (/var/log/mailman/subscribe) latom hogy pending subscrbe-en van a felhasznalo.

Mas emailcimre se kuldd, de meg a lokalis emailcimekre se jon meg a confiramtion level. Postfix nem logol ezzel kapcoslatban semmit a /var/log/mail.* fajlokba.

Merre tudok elindulni?
(postfix kifogastalanul mukodik a mailmanon kivul)

Udv,
Khiraly

1. Melyik mailman 2.0.x, vagy 2.1.x? Ha 2.1.x, akkor futtatni kell a qrunner daemont. Szoval lehet, hogy egy mailman start megoldja a gondot. 2.0.x-nel a cronbol futtatja a qrunner-t. Nezd meg, hogy a cron fut-e, illetve benne vannak-e a bejegyzesek.

2. Alias file be van allitva megfeleloen?

3. newaliases, postfix reload volt?

Mas otlet egyelore nincs. Nekem sarge-on gond nelkul ment elsore postfixszel.

Udv,
Zoli

[quote:d2ae248941="khiraly"]Sziasztok!

Feltettem debianra a mailman-t. Eddig postfix volt, mint smtp szerver.
Szepen megy a webes felulete a mailmannak listat is letre tudok hozni.
Fel is tudok iratkozni, DE a confirmation emailt mar nem kapom meg. Listara mar nem tudok kuldeni.

mailman logokban (/var/log/mailman/subscribe) latom hogy pending subscrbe-en van a felhasznalo.

Mas emailcimre se kuldd, de meg a lokalis emailcimekre se jon meg a confiramtion level. Postfix nem logol ezzel kapcoslatban semmit a /var/log/mail.* fajlokba.

Merre tudok elindulni?
(postfix kifogastalanul mukodik a mailmanon kivul)

Udv,
Khiraly

Szia!

A figyelmedbe szeretnem ajanlani a /usr/share/doc/mailman/README.POSTFIX.gz filet. Szepen minden le van irva. Egyebkent az ilyen levelkuldesi problemanak tobb oka lehet,de szeritnem erre mind kiternek a leirasban.

[quote:5f8f85afd7="petres"]
1. Melyik mailman 2.0.x, vagy 2.1.x? Ha 2.1.x, akkor futtatni kell a qrunner daemont. Szoval lehet, hogy egy mailman start megoldja a gondot. 2.0.x-nel a cronbol futtatja a qrunner-t. Nezd meg, hogy a cron fut-e, illetve benne vannak-e a bejegyzesek.

2. Alias file be van allitva megfeleloen?

3. newaliases, postfix reload volt?

1. mailman 2.1.5 -os verzio (SID-ben levo)
3. volt newalias es postfix reload is.

2. alias fajlok:
/etc/postfix/main.cf idevago tartalma:
[code:1:5f8f85afd7]
alias_maps = hash:/etc/aliases
alias_database = hash:/etc/aliases
myorigin = /etc/mailname

virtual_alias_maps = mysql:/etc/postfix/mysql_virtual_alias_maps.cf
virtual_mailbox_maps = mysql:/etc/postfix/mysql_virtual_mailbox_maps.cf
[/code:1:5f8f85afd7]

Az /etc/aliases idevago resze

mailer-daemon: postmaster
## mailman levelezolista
mailman: "|/var/lib/mailman/mail/mailman post mailman"
mailman-admin: "|/var/lib/mailman/mail/mailman admin mailman"
mailman-bounces: "|/var/lib/mailman/mail/mailman bounces mailman"
mailman-confirm: "|/var/lib/mailman/mail/mailman confirm mailman"
mailman-join: "|/var/lib/mailman/mail/mailman join mailman"
mailman-leave: "|/var/lib/mailman/mail/mailman leave mailman"
mailman-owner: "|/var/lib/mailman/mail/mailman owner mailman"
mailman-request: "|/var/lib/mailman/mail/mailman request mailman"
mailman-subscribe: "|/var/lib/mailman/mail/mailman subscribe mailman"
mailman-unsubscribe: "|/var/lib/mailman/mail/mailman unsubscribe mailman"

A /etc/postfix/mysql_virtual_alias_maps.cf
[code:1:5f8f85afd7]
user = postfix
password = xxxx
hosts = localhost
dbname = xxxx
table = alias
select_field = goto
where_field = address
[/code:1:5f8f85afd7]

A mysql -ben levo alias tabla:
[code:1:5f8f85afd7]
select * from alias;
+-------------------+-------------------+--------+---------------------+---------------------+--------+
| address | goto | domain | created | modified | active |
+-------------------+-------------------+--------+---------------------+---------------------+--------+
| user@domainem.hu | user@domainem.hu | | 0000-00-00 00:00:00 | 0000-00-00 00:00:00 | 1 |
+-------------------+-------------------+--------+---------------------+---------------------+--------+
1 row in set (0.00 sec)
[/code:1:5f8f85afd7]

Udv,
Khiraly

Ujrainditottam a mailman-t. Es most ugy nez ki, hogy szetkuldte a sok reggelo kerest.

Viszont a postfix nem fogadja a levlistas leveleket(/var/log/syslog):
[code:1:a6eb90279b]
Dec 21 16:16:07 elite postfix/smtpd[29818]: NOQUEUE: reject: RCPT from b.relay.invitel.net[62.77.203.4]: 550 <xxx@yyy.hu>: Recipient address rejected: User unknown in local recipient table; from=<khiraly123@gmx.net> to=<xxx@yyy.hu> proto=ESMTP helo=<b.relay.invitel.net>
Dec 21 16:16:07 elite postfix/smtpd[29818]: disconnect from b.relay.invitel.net[62.77.203.4]

[/code:1:a6eb90279b]

Szoval a postfix nem adja tovabb a leveleket a mailmannak, hanem visszavagja.

Udv,
Khiraly

Az elozo hozzaszolasomra a megoldas a kovetkezo:
[code:1:c8d93478b1]
alias_maps = hash:/etc/aliases, hash:/var/lib/mailman/data/aliases
[/code:1:c8d93478b1]

Ezt kellett hozzaadnom a /etc/postfix/main.cf fajlomhoz.

Ami mukodik:
Tudok uj levlista tagokat regisztralni (elkuldi a confimation-t es weben keresztul megy is).
A listara kuldott level megjon a tobbi listatagnak.

VISZONT a webes archivumba nem jelennek meg az uzenetek.
Ennek milyen gyakori a frissitese?

Udv,
Khiraly

Az alabbi opciok vannak kipipalva az [Archiving Options] -nel (lista administration felulete):
[code:1:966d05351d]
Archive messages? Yes
Is archive file source for public or private archival? public
How often should a new archive volume be started? Monthly
[/code:1:966d05351d]

[quote:64abb23d22="khiraly"]

Sziasztok!

Szoval mukodik mostmar minden szepen, koszonom a segitsegeteket.
Egy kicsit varni kellett es a webes archivum is frissult.

Udv,
Khiraly

Sziasztok!

Beállítottam a mailmant Debian Etch alá, postfix-el. Azon a gépen, ahol a mailman is van, squirrelmail és courier-imap is fut.

A jelenség:

Megcsinálom a listát, gmail-es cím a listadmin, rendesen kimegy neki az üdvözlő levél. Viszont a listára nem tud írni, "550 relay not permitted"-el jön vissza a levél. Ha a squirrelmail-ből írok a listára (persze miután feliratkoztattam a címet az admin felületről), az rendben meg is érkezik a squirreles címre, de a gmail-re nem. Mi lehet itt a probléma?

Ellenpróbaként, a squrrelről közvetlenü a gmailre, és fordítva gond nélkül jönnek-mennek a levelek.

Van ötletetek?

Petya

Petya szerintem futtasd le genaliases-t és akkor nem fog lehalni a postfix ha hozzáadod a main.cf-ben a data/aliases-t

bővebben:
http://www.gnu.org/software/mailman/mailman-install/node13.html

Az én problémám a következő (postfix-mailman):
a listát létrehoztam, felvettem egy mail címet tehát volt jóváhagyó mail minden, csak éppen az nem megy hogy a felvett mail cím ha levelet küld a listára akkor az megjelenjen az archívumban és megkapja ő maga (az erre vonatkozó pipa be van pipálva)

tsab@gmail.com lenne az emberünk
és levlista nevű listára akar küldeni mailt
a levlista email címe levlista@server.ath.cx

a syslog a következőt dobja amikor megkapja a mailt:

Sep 9 21:32:01 sunlion postfix/qmgr[5432]: A86D96D945: from=tsab@gmail.com, size=2049, nrcpt=1 (queue active)
Sep 9 21:32:01 sunlion local[5568]: fatal: execvp /var/lib/levlista/mail/levlista: No such file or directory
Sep 9 21:32:01 sunlion postfix/local[5567]: A86D96D945: to=levlista@server.ath.cx, relay=local, delay=1689, delays=1689/0.01/0/0.01, dsn=4.3.0, status=deferred (temporary failure. Command output: local: fatal: execvp /var/lib/levlista/mail/levlista: No such file or directory )

nem tudom miért keresi a levlista könyvtárat a /var/lib-ben illetve egyáltalán nem tudok mit kezdeni ezzel azt sem hogy merre kéne elindulni